Quantcast
Channel: SCN: Message List
Viewing all articles
Browse latest Browse all 10449

BLOQUEAR FACTURA

$
0
0

Buenas tardes

 

estoy realizando un transaction notification pero al ejecutarlo no me realiza la operación deseada

lo que quier es que al facturar me bloquee la factura cuando cumple con ciertas condiciones ,

este es el código ,   lo guardo y no genera error , pero al ejecutarlo en SAP me deja facturar sin problema y no me bloquea la factura como es lo deseado :

EL CAMPO: _U_TIPO_CLIENTE   Y     U_IMPUESTOS son campos de usuario creados en el formulario de facturas

espero me puedan decir cual es el error en el código

 

 

IF @object_type = 13 and @transaction_type in  ('A','U')

BEGIN

declare @clase_cliente  varchar (100)

declare @impuestos varchar (100)

 

 

select @clase_cliente = OINV.U_TIPO_CLIENTE

FROM OINV

WHERE  @list_of_cols_val_tab_del=OINV.DocEntry

 

 

select @impuestos = OINV.U_IMPUESTOS

FROM OINV

WHERE @list_of_cols_val_tab_del=OINV.DocEntry

 

 

IF @clase_cliente ='100' and @impuestos = 'IVA_EXE'

BEGIN

select @error = 1

select @error_message = 'ES CLIENTE CON IVA EXENTO'

end

END

 

 

Gracias...... por la ayuda


Viewing all articles
Browse latest Browse all 10449